## Deploying the Gatewick Proctor Queue

Deploys are pretty painless: push to main, wait for the pipeline, then watch the queue drain dashboard for five minutes. If candidates pile up mid-exam, roll back first and ask questions later — the queue replays safely. Everything the workers care about lives in one config block, shown here for reference.

settings of bafof-yagef:
JOROX_PIN=8740
JOROX_TENANT=pelox
JOROX_METRICS_HOST=metrics.jorox.qorvelworks.internal
JOROX_SEAL=seal_c78f63c1
JOROX_STANDBY_TEAM=norax

### Scan Submission Endpoint

Heads-up for review: the Beepwell barcode integration posts decoded scans to our `/scans` endpoint over TLS only — plaintext is rejected outright. Payloads carry the device serial and a decode timestamp, nothing personal. Rate limiting kicks in at 30 scans per second per device, which is generous. Every request must carry the bearer token shown directly below.

session JWT of yawep-yawep = eyJhbGciOiJIUzI1NiIsInR5cCI6IkpXVCJ9.eyJzdWIiOiI3pWF3_In0.aXYsHiog

## Break-glass access — Emberline firmware channel

This page is for external plugin authors publishing to the Emberline device-firmware update channel. Normally you cannot pause or retract a firmware rollout once signed; only the channel steward can. If a rollout is actively bricking devices and no steward responds within fifteen minutes, break-glass access applies. Open the channel console, select Emergency Halt, and when prompted, enter the recovery passphrase, which is:

vault phrase of kafog-kahif = holdor-rusir-praox